In theory, it's the Khalifa (Caliph/Califf), the "Deputy" of Mohammed, who leads the Faithful of the Ummah, the collective of Islam. Many people have assumed the title of Khalifa, but only the first four or five of them came close to pulling it off. There is no khalifa today.
